In Makerfield, the Green Party faces a strategic crossroads: back Labour’s Andy Burnham in the by-election to potentially influence future electoral reform, or stay true to their principles and fight both Labour and Reform. With Burnham narrowly ahead of Reform and the Greens far behind, some argue a tactical retreat could pave the way for proportional representation — a system that could give Greens 71 seats instead of just four. Leadership says the final call rests with local members as they pick a new candidate, while polls show Labour’s seat is fiercely contested — and could be lost without Burnham.
